#111356 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#111356 is composed of 6.7% red, 7.5%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.2% cyan, 77.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 66.3% black. It has a hue angle of 238.3 degrees, a saturation of 67% and a lightness of 20.2%. #111356 color hex could be obtained by blending #2226ac with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000066.

● #111356 color description : Very dark blue.
#111356 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#111356 has RGB values of R:17, G:19, B:86 and CMYK values of C:0.8, M:0.78, Y:0, K:0.66. Its decimal value is 1119062.

Shades and Tints of #111356
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010104 is the darkest color, while #f3f3f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#111356
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#313136 is the less saturated color, while #010466 is the most saturated one.
